Kalash Valley is located in the remote south western part of District Chitral. The area is gifted with unique cultural and biological diversity. The natural forest of the area mainly consists of pine (Pinus wallichiana), chlghoza (Pinus gerardiana), deodar (Cedrus deodara) and broad leaf species like oak (Quercus incana).
